Chihiro All You Can Eat Japanese Restaurant Croydon

Open
Call

Advertisement

123 Main St
Croydon, Victoria 3136
Own this business?
See a problem?

You might also like

AustraliaVictoriaChihiro All You Can Eat Japanese Restaurant Croydon

Advertisement